Output 50c0323d759e26156b269c6b206ba7572a19bdc7e8ae65522066f0d1b668f635:4

value
33257
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ff07c879e22b14ab3576b6ace4512255887656d5 OP_EQUALVERIFY OP_CHECKSIG
address
1QFUdhQihpuTxLfgjUj1bsYz1wTi1LNDgb
transaction
50c0323d759e26156b269c6b206ba7572a19bdc7e8ae65522066f0d1b668f635
confirmations
408838
spent
true